Select Files
or drag and drop files here
Select an image to convert
The Challenge
Modern formats (WebP, AVIF, HEIC) offer superior compression but fail across ecosystems. Outlook blocks WebP email attachments. IE11/older Safari can't render AVIF. Windows 10 doesn't open HEIC photos from iPhones without codec packs. Enterprise systems reject non-JPG uploads. JPG works everywhere: all browsers back to Netscape, every email client, all social platforms, legacy enterprise software, government portals, print services. Converting modern formats to JPG sacrifices 10-15% additional file size for zero compatibility friction. For photos, JPG compression removes invisible high-frequency data—reduces PNG files 70-85% while maintaining visual quality at 85% setting. Email attachment limits (25MB Gmail, 10MB Outlook) become non-issues.
Why JPG Remains The Universal Standard
Newer formats offer better compression ratios, but JPG remains the only format guaranteed to display correctly on every device manufactured in the last 25 years. This includes legacy government kiosks, older point-of-sale systems, and email servers that strip unknown file types. WebP and AVIF save space, yet they require modern browser support that lacks universal adoption in enterprise or government environments.
Optimal Quality Settings By Use Case
- Web display: 85% quality yields 70-85% smaller files with no visible loss at 100% zoom
- Print 8x10 inches: 95% quality preserves detail for large format output
- Email attachments: 80% quality ensures files stay under 25MB Gmail limits
- Social media: 82% quality balances upload speed with platform recompression
- Archival: 100% quality retains maximum data for future reprocessing
JPG Conversion Tradeoffs
Transparency Conversion Limitation
The tool converts all transparent pixels to a solid background color because the JPG format does not support alpha channels. This process creates visible halos around feathered edges or anti-aliased borders.
Step-by-Step Workflow
Upload Source Images
Select Output Format
Adjust Quality Settings
Choose Background Color
Download Converted Files
Specifications
- Output Format
- JPG JPEG PNG WebP
- Quality Range
- 1% to 100%
- Transparency Handling
- Solid Background Color
- Data Removal
- EXIF Metadata Stripped
Best Practices
- Use 85% quality for photos to balance file size and visual fidelity
- Avoid converting PNG graphics with text to JPG to prevent compression artifacts
- Match background color to destination to eliminate white halos on transparent images
Frequently Asked Questions
What quality settings for different use cases?
Web display: 85% (invisible loss, optimal size). Print 8×10 or larger: 90-95% (preserve detail). Email attachments: 80% (balance quality/size for 25MB limits). Social media: 82-85% (platforms recompress anyway). Thumbnails: 70-75% (artifacts invisible at small size). Archival: 95-100% (maximum preservation). Professional photography clients: 90-95% (demonstrable quality). Test at actual display size—100% zoom artifacts disappear at 50% view.
Why white border appears around my converted image?
Original had transparency that converted to white background (JPG default). Transparent pixels must become solid—JPG format doesn't support alpha channels. Solutions: 1) Choose background color matching destination before converting (blue for blue website), 2) Crop transparent borders before conversion, 3) Use PNG/WebP if transparency required. White halos occur when transparent edges feather into solid background—anti-aliasing assumes wrong color.
Can I recover original quality by converting JPG back to PNG?
No. JPG discards data permanently via lossy compression—converting to PNG just wraps compressed data in lossless container (often larger file, zero quality gain). Original detail is unrecoverable. Always keep uncompressed source files (PSD/TIFF/PNG). Workflow: edit in PNG → final export to JPG. Never iteratively edit JPGs—quality degrades each save. If you must edit JPG, save as PNG until finished, then export JPG once.
My JPG file is still 5MB after conversion. How to reduce?
Large JPGs indicate: 1) High resolution—4000×3000 photo at 85% = 3-5MB. Solution: resize to display dimensions first (web: 1920×1080 max, email: 1200×800). 2) Quality too high—lower to 80% for web. 3) Complex content—sunset gradients compress poorly. Solutions: crop to subject, reduce dimensions, use JPG Compress tool for additional lossless optimization (quantization table tuning saves 10-20% more). For web, aim for under 500KB per image.
Does PNG to JPG conversion always reduce file size?
For photos: yes, typically 70-85% smaller. For graphics/text: sometimes larger with quality loss. PNG excels at solid colors and sharp edges (logos, screenshots, diagrams)—compresses via pattern repetition. JPG optimizes smooth gradients (photos)—compresses via DCT frequency analysis. Converting flat-color graphic to JPG often produces larger file with blocky artifacts. Decision rule: photo content → JPG, graphic content → PNG. Test: if image has 10+ distinct solid colors with sharp boundaries, keep PNG.
What happens to transparent areas in complex images?
All transparent pixels convert to selected background color—tool doesn't distinguish semi-transparent from fully transparent. For images with alpha-blended edges (feathered shadows, anti-aliased borders), conversion uses chosen solid color. Result may show hard edges where gradual transparency existed. Workaround: 1) Edit in Photoshop/GIMP to flatten transparency onto preferred background before conversion, 2) Use WebP if modern browser compatibility acceptable, 3) Keep PNG if transparency critical to design.
Why does my 100% quality JPG still show artifacts?
JPG is inherently lossy—even 100% quality discards data, just minimally. Artifacts appear in: 1) Smooth gradients—8×8 DCT blocks create banding. 2) Sharp edges—ringing around text/lines. 3) Fine textures—high-frequency detail loss. 100% uses minimal quantization but compression still occurs. For truly lossless conversion, use PNG. JPG's strength is photographic content where luminance/chroma loss is imperceptible. For pixel-perfect graphics, JPG is wrong format regardless of quality setting.
Related Guides
Convert to PNG
- PNG
- Lossless DEFLATE
- 8-bit Alpha Channel
Convert to WebP
- WebP
- 25 to 35 percent versus JPG
- 96 percent coverage
Compress JPG Images
- 80% (50-60% size reduction)
- 70% (60-80% size reduction)
- 85-90% (40-50% size reduction)
Compress PNG Images
- Lossless (zero quality loss)
- 40-70% for unoptimized PNGs
- 5-20% additional savings
Compress WebP Images
- 80 to 85 percent
- 96 percent of modern browsers
- 25 to 35 percent smaller at same quality
Etsy Seller Tools: Resize Images for Listings, Banners & Profiles
Resize Product Photos to 3000×2250 for Etsy Listings
- 3000x2250 pixels
- 4:3
- 1MB
Resize Profile Picture to 500×500 for Etsy Shops
- 500×500 pixels (1:1 ratio)
- Under 200KB (150KB optimal)
- JPG, PNG (JPG recommended)
Resize Shop Banner to 3360×840 for Etsy
- 3360×840 pixels
- 1200×300 pixels
- JPG, PNG
Resize Images to 1080×1350 for Instagram Feed Posts
- 1080x1350 Pixels (4:5)
- 1012x1350 Pixels (3:4)
- JPG, PNG, BMP, Non-Animated GIF
Resize Images to 1080×1920 for Instagram Stories & Reels
- 1080×1920 Pixels
- 9:16
- 1080×1420 Pixels
Resize Images to 1584×396 for LinkedIn Profile Banners
- 1584×396 Pixels
- 4:1
- 8 MB
Resize Images to 1280×720 for YouTube Thumbnails
- 1280×720 Pixels
- 16:9
- 2 MB
Convert Nested API JSON Response to CSV Spreadsheet
- JSON File
- Auto-Detect
- Configurable
Convert Stripe JSON Export to CSV Spreadsheet
- Stripe JSON Export
- Nested Objects With Dot Notation
- CSV Or Excel
Convert Binary to Decimal for Programming: Debug Bitwise Operations
- Binary → Decimal
- Bitwise operations, flag debugging
- 64 bits (JavaScript safe integer)
Convert HEX Color Codes to Decimal RGB for Web Development
- Hex → Decimal
- CSS colors to RGB, Canvas API
- FF5733 or #FF5733 (both accepted)